Action Bronson Lands Late Night Show
Action Bronson (real name Arian Asllani ) is getting more TV time. The TV host, who is a rapper and former chef, has landed a new Snapchat dating show that premieres Aug. 30. Viceland has also renewed his culinary travel show, F—, That’s Delicious, for a third season. And if that’s not enough of Bronson on the small screen, the 33-year-old is working with the network to develop a daily late night show slated to launch in late 2017.
The new late night show will have two time slots on Viceland and will be placed alongside the network’s other late night series, Desus & Mero. An official title has not yet been confirmed.
In other Action Bronson news, his new cookbook will be released Sept. 12th and his new album, Blue Chips 7000, will be released on Aug. 25
